What to do when you are only 18 and no credit record, and no co-signer?? for a private bank loan?

The best way to establish credit on your own is to apply for a secured credit card. You will put down a deposit, usually as low as $150.00 and your credit limit will probably be close to the same. There is also an annual fee so check around to find the lowest. Use the card and make 6 months of consistent payments and that will establish a credit history for you. Usually they will refund your deposit if you make consistent payments after six months or a year. Read the details. Good luck.
